INTRODUCTION TO CHEMICAL REACTIONS

Level: Level One

In successfully completing this unit, the learner will haveEvidence needed

demonstrated the ability to

1. carry out an experiment investigating how changing concentration affects the reaction rate

Student completed work and/or summary sheet

2. carry out an experiment investigating how changing temperature affects the reaction rate

Student completed work and/or summary sheet

3. carry out an experiment investigating how changing surface area affects the reaction rate

Student completed work and/or summary sheet

4. carry out an experiment investigating how adding a catalyst affects the rate of reaction for the release of oxygen

Student completed work and/or summary sheet

5. carry out an experiment investigating how catalysts occur in living cells

Student completed work and/or summary sheet

shown knowledge of

6. the fact that yeast contains a catalyst and is used in baking and brewing.

Summary sheet
